Branko Ushkovski is the new president of the Judicial Council

With 13 out of 14 votes, Branko Ushkovski, the only candidate, was elected president of the Judicial Council. One of the ballots was invalid. He said that he will conscientiously and responsibly perform the function and will work together with colleagues who elected him president. Tsipras nominates Provopulos for President

Prime Minister Alexis Tsipras nominated Prokopis Pavlopoulos, former minister of New Democracy, as a candidate for President of Greece. Provopulos is a surprise because we recently vociferously heard the name of the current Greek Commissioner Dimitris Avramopoulos as favorite for President. Zhelyu Zhelev, the first to recognize Macedonia, dies

Today, at 79 years of age, first democratically elected President of Bulgaria, Dr. Zhelyu Zhelev, passed away, announced the press secretariat of the presidential office, reports agency BTA.
